Which companies sponsor visas for account associates in Iowa?
Des Moines-based financial and insurance firms are among the most active sponsors for account associate roles in Iowa. Principal Financial Group, Nationwide, and EMC Insurance have sponsored international workers in client services and account management functions. Agricultural technology companies like Pioneer (a Corteva brand) and logistics firms operating out of Iowa also appear in federal sponsorship disclosures for similar roles.
Which visa types are most common for account associate roles in Iowa?
The H-1B visa is the most common visa for account associates in Iowa, provided the role q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business, finance, or marketing. Some candidates enter through OPT or STEM OPT extensions after graduating from Iowa universities, using that period to secure full H-1B sponsorship from their employer.
Which cities in Iowa have the most account associate sponsorship jobs?
Des Moines accounts for the majority of account associate sponsorship activity in Iowa, driven by its concentration of insurance carriers, financial services firms, and corporate headquarters. Cedar Rapids is a secondary hub, with employers in insurance, manufacturing, and logistics sectors. Iowa City and Ames see some activity tied to university-affiliated employers and technology-adjacent companies near their respective campuses.

Are there any Iowa-specific considerations for account associates seeking visa sponsorship?
Iowa's cost of living means prevailing wage requirements for account associate roles are generally lower than in coastal metros, which can make sponsorship more financially straightforward for employers. Graduates from the University of Iowa, Iowa State University, and University of Northern Iowa have established pipelines into Des Moines-area employers, and finishing a degree in-state can strengthen local employer relationships before pursuing sponsorship.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ored account associate jobs in Iowa?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
